Documentation : la mémoire vive de votre actif numérique

Dans l’ingénierie logicielle classique, la documentation est souvent perçue comme une contrainte, reléguée en fin de projet ou rapidement obsolète. Chez AxioCode, nous considérons la documentation comme une composante intrinsèque du code. Grâce à l’ingénierie augmentée, nous produisons une documentation fonctionnelle et technique exhaustive, générée et mise à jour en temps réel.

Une documentation continue par l'ingénierie augmentée

L’intégration d’agents d’IA au cœur de notre chaîne de production garantit que la connaissance technique ne se perd jamais, même lors d’évolutions rapides du système.

Qualité et fiabilité

nos agents documentent chaque brique logicielle au moment précis de sa création ou de sa modification. Cela garantit une parfaite adéquation entre le code exécuté et sa description.

Gains de productivité et de budget

l’automatisation de la rédaction technique libère nos experts pour des tâches de conception à haute valeur ajoutée, tout en réduisant les coûts futurs de maintenance et d’onboarding.

Pérennité du savoir

vous disposez d’un référentiel technique toujours à jour, éliminant la dépendance critique envers les individus et sécurisant votre patrimoine immatériel.

Un double référentiel
pour une maîtrise totale

Sous la supervision de nos leads techniques et business analysts,
nos agents produisent et maintiennent deux niveaux de documentation indispensables :
1

Documentation Technique

Elle détaille l’implémentation réelle de la solution pour les équipes de développement et d’exploitation.

  • Architecture et flux : cartographie des composants, des services tiers et des interactions inter-systèmes.
  • Dictionnaire de données : structure de la base de données, relations et règles d’intégrité.
  • Référentiel API : documentation interactive des points d’entrée et des contrats d’interface.
  • Guide de déploiement : configuration de la chaîne CI/CD (GitLab) et des environnements.
2

Documentation Fonctionnelle

Elle traduit le comportement de l’application en langage métier pour les utilisateurs et les décideurs.

  • Règles de gestion : description précise des logiques métiers implémentées dans le code, selon le formalisme UML (fonctionnalités, cas d’utilisation, exigences, diagrammes utiles).
  • Parcours utilisateurs : guides d’utilisation et scénarios de navigation mis à jour selon les évolutions de l’interface.
  • Matrice de traçabilité : lien direct entre les exigences initiales et les fonctionnalités livrées.

Souveraineté et réversibilité

La documentation en temps réel est la garantie d’une souveraineté numérique effective :

Auditabilité permanente

votre système est transparent et peut être audité à tout moment par vos services internes ou des tiers.

Réversibilité simplifiée

la clarté de la documentation facilite la reprise en main de l’application (internalisation ou transfert), supprimant l’effet « boîte noire ».

Réduction de la dette technique

une documentation à jour permet d’identifier et de corriger plus rapidement les obsolescences avant qu’elles ne deviennent critiques.

« Le document est une vraie réussite, mais également, cela nous a permis à nous, qui reprenions le projet en interne, de mieux nous approprier notre propre outil. […] AxioCode nous a montré que l’on pouvait de nouveau faire confiance à un prestataire, ce qui était nécessaire après notre expérience précédente. »